14:22 — Deryn confirmed that the encoding sniffer in UploadGate was misclassifying UTF-16LE files without a BOM as Windows-1252, which explained the mojibake reports from the Harlow Notes team. The fallback heuristic had been silently disabled during the Quillbrook refactor three sprints earlier, and no regression test covered BOM-less inputs. We patched the sniffer to sample the first 4KB and score null-byte distribution before guessing. The fix was verified against all 1,900 corpus files and shipped in the trace referenced below.

session token of tajef-bageg = htk21_5d90d574934f3ccae6437

## Changelog — Font vendoring defaults changed

As of this release, the Bracken UI build no longer fetches third-party fonts at build time. All typefaces used by the Lanternwell suite are now vendored into the repo under a dedicated assets directory, and the fetch step is skipped by default. If you're onboarding, nothing to install — the fonts travel with the checkout. The build flags controlling this behavior are listed below.

settings of hadup-yafog:
LAMAEL_PIN=3761
LAMAEL_TENANT=istmir
LAMAEL_METRICS_HOST=metrics.lamael.plorvasys.test
LAMAEL_SEAL=seal_8ea68500
LAMAEL_STANDBY_TEAM=fraok

/*
 * Partner SFTP drop client setup — Ferndale Exchange plugin API.
 * Plugins push nightly batches to the Quillmark drop zone via this client.
 * Do not hardcode host paths; pull them from the manifest.
 * Retries: 3, exponential backoff. Files over 2 GB are rejected upstream.
 * Compression must be gzip; tarballs are silently dropped.
 * Auth is handled by the internal Gatewright token service, not SFTP keys.
 * The Gatewright key to use for this client follows below.
 */

app token of kawif-yafop = zpat2_88